Old School & Home Cooked | Nightwatch Ep.53

from Nightwatch · host Signal Flare Studio

Join the closer-in-chief with Big Smoke and Jolly Green for a late-night, laugh-packed episode of Nightwatch, where the trio winds down after the holidays by swapping food memories and work war stories. The hosts talk Christmas dinners—scalloped potatoes vs. au gratin, green bean casserole, ham—and share personal cooking evolutions from boxed mac’n’cheese to mixing multiple cheeses, sous-vide steaks, and creative wing glazes. There’s a running riff about baked beans on a baked potato, improvised sauces, the Hot Ones phenomenon, and the eternal ranch vs. blue cheese debate. The conversation shifts to life on the night shift: staffing problems, no-call/no-show policies, and a mandatory New Year’s Eve blackout that’s led to fired employees and mounting burnout. The hosts describe their own coping strategies—door-dashing, commutes, sleeping through recovery periods—and reveal how corporate pressure and turnover have changed the workplace vibe. Anecdotes include odd hires, team dynamics, and the difficulty of keeping a consistent routine for podcasting and life. They also chew on pop-culture distractions that keep them awake: bingeing shows like Yellowstone and The Landman, rediscovering classic TV serials, and how late-night TV becomes a comfort during long downtime. Between joking jabs and surprising admissions (microwaved wings, frozen chicken hacks, and the knack for cooking when feeding others), the hosts keep it candid, often preferring genuine reactions over polite praise. Expect a mix of humor, grit, and everyday wisdom—food talk that turns into life talk—plus practical takeaways about managing schedules, the value of gifts and hospitality, and why a good sauce can change everything. Tune in for the relaxed, unfiltered banter that defines Nightwatch and hear what to expect if you’re on the late shift, looking for laughs, or just hungry for good stories.
